Elementary Special Education is the 367th most popular major in the country with 1,422 degrees awarded in 2019-2020.

Across Ohio, there were 6 elementary special education gra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 6 elementary special education graduates with average earnings and debt of $38,281 and $26,151 respectively.

Heidelberg University

Tiffin, Ohio
#1 in overall quality

Out of the 1 schools in the Best Value Elementary Special Ed Schools for a Bachelor’s in Ohio that were part of this year’s ranking, Heidelberg University landed the #1 spot on the list. This small school is located in Tiffin, Ohio, and it awarded 6 bachelors’s elementary special ed degrees in 2019-2020.

Heidelburg College also made our “Best Elementary Special Education Bachelor’s Degree Schools in Ohio” list, coming in at #1. The yearly cost to attend Heidelberg University is $20,893 for Ohio Bachelor’s Degree Elementary Special Ed students.
